Watercraft Types Overview
Choosing the right boat for your scenic experience can make all the difference in how you enjoy the beauty of the waters around you. Each boat type delivers unique advantages suited to your needs. For a relaxing outing, a pontoon boat provides spacious seating and stability, ideal for unwinding with friends or family. If you're after speed and agility, consider a motorboat, which allows you traverse large distances quickly while exploring hidden coves. For a more intimate experience, a kayak or canoe allows you to glide quietly through serene waters, surrounding yourself in nature. If you want to fish while enjoying the scenery, a fishing boat is ideal. Finally, your choice shapes the adventure ahead, so pick wisely!

Key Considerations When Renting a Boat
Exploring hidden gems on a boat is an thrilling experience, but it's important to keep a few key factors in mind before you hit the water. First, consider your experience level. If you're just starting out to boating, seek out options that offer a captain or guided tours. Next, think about the size of the boat you'll need. Larger groups will require bigger vessels, while smaller boats are great for intimate outings. Check the rental company's safety equipment and policies—life jackets and insurance are must-haves. Also, review the rental duration and any additional fees for fuel or cleaning. Finally, familiarize yourself with local regulations and navigation rules to secure a fun, hassle-free adventure on the water.

What Styles of Boats Are Available for Rental?
You can find numerous boats ready to rent, including motorized vessels, pontoon boats, canoes, and kayaks. Each selection provides a unique way to navigate the water, meeting different tastes and experience levels.
Do Life Jackets Come With Boat Rentals?
Yes, most boat rentals include life jackets to ensure your safety. When you rent, confirm with the rental company to make sure you have the correct quantity and sizes for all passengers. Always prioritize safety!
Can You Rent a Boat With No Prior Experience?
Absolutely, renting a boat is possible even without previous experience! Most boat rental services provide short training sessions or guidance. Make sure to mention your experience level to receive proper assistance and safety instructions.
What Clothing Should I Wear When Boating?
You'll want to wear comfortable clothing that dries quickly, a swimsuit if it's warm, and robust footwear. Don't forget a hat and sunglasses for protection from the sun, plus a light jacket for fresh breezes. Safety is key!
Are There Any Age Requirements for Boat Rentals?
There are indeed age limitations for boat rentals. You'll need to be a minimum of 18 or 21 years old, which varies by rental provider. Be sure to verify local rules to ensure compliance.
